Description

We believe that as Christians, we are constantly being formed in the way of Jesus for the sake of the world. We desire to be transformed people who experience vibrant spiritual growth and we want the Spirit of God to shape us more and more into the likeness of Jesus. Join Dr. Barry Jones, Sissy Mathew, and Isaac Harris each week as they navigate relevant topics through honest conversations.
